CONNECTING FIREPLACE
TO GAS SUPPLY
Installation Items Needed
• Phillips screwdriver
• sealant (resistant to propane/LP gas, not
provided)
1.
Route flexible gas line (provided by
installer) from equipment shutoff
valve into fireplace through side or
rear access holes in outer casing (see
Figure 21).
NOTICE: Most building codes do
not permit concealed gas con-
nections. A flexible gas line is
provided to allow accessibility
from the fireplace (see Figure 23).
The flexible gas supply line con-
nection to the equipment shutoff
valve should be accessible.
2.
Apply pipe joint sealant lightly to male
threads of gas connector attached to
flexible gas line (see Figure 22). Con-
nect flexible gas line to flexible gas line
attached to gas valve of fireplace (see
Figure 22).
3. Check all gas connections for leaks. See
Checking Gas Connections, page 14.
4.
Feed flexible gas line into fireplace base
area. Make sure the entire flexible gas
line is in fireplace mantel base area.
CAUTION: Avoid damage to
regulator. Hold gas regulator with
wrench when connecting it to gas
piping and/or fittings.
